Radare is a portable reversing framework that can...
    Disassemble (and assemble for) many different architectures
    Debug with local native and remote debuggers (gdb, rap, webui, r2pipe, winedbg, windbg)
    Run on Linux, *BSD, Windows, OSX, Android, iOS, Solaris and Haiku
    Perform forensics on filesystems and data carving
    Be scripted in Python, Javascript, Go and more
    Support collaborative analysis using the embedded webserver
    Visualize data structures of several file types
    Patch programs to uncover new features or fix vulnerabilities
    Use powerful analysis capabilities to speed up reversing
    Aid in software exploitation
